Abstract:
This paper designed the optimal routing algorithm for vehicular networks and simulated it based on the two-year GPS data of 4 000 taxis in Shanghai.The optimal algorithm,on the one hand,revealed the inefficiency of existing routing algorithms.And on the other hand,its actual routing traces suggested a map-based static structured routing strategy with dynamic weights.Simulations showed that the performance of this new practical routing strategy,compared with other existing routing algorithms,has an improvement of 50%.
